Spanish guitar party band in Valencia for weddings and Fallas
Picture this: the dinner’s done, people are chatting, and you need the room to switch gears. That’s where this Valencia group really shines. They play upbeat Spanish party music driven by guitars, handclaps, and a modern flamenco flavour, mixed with rumbas that feel sunny and punchy. It fits weddings especially well when you want the main set to feel like a proper celebration, not background noise.
They’re also a great match for Fallas events, where the energy has to be fun and communal, with choruses people can grab onto even if they don’t know the songs. If you’re searching how to hire a band in Valencia for a wedding party or a private celebration, this is the kind of group that keeps it friendly, keeps it moving, and knows when to push the tempo so the night actually takes off.
They’ve got that warm Spanish street party sound: guitars up front, tight rhythms, and vocals that feel like someone singing right to your table. The mood is upbeat but not forced, more “everyone ends up joining in” than “look at us on stage.” When the moment calls for it, they crank it up and make the main part of the night feel like a shared thing, not just entertainment. In private parties, they’re the type that turns a mixed crowd into one group, fast. You can tell they’re used to real celebrations in Valencia, not just ticking boxes.
